Data Center Technical Writer Location
This position can be remote (Work from Home) and is located in the state of Texas. Responsibilities
Create and maintain technical documentation for data center operations, including standard operating procedures (SOPs), user manuals, and troubleshooting guides. Collaborate with subject matter experts to gather information and translate complex technical concepts into clear, concise, and user-friendly documentation. Develop and update diagrams, process flows, and other visual aids to support written documentation as necessary. Ensure all documentation adheres to company standards, industry best practices, and regulatory requirements. Review and edit existing documentation for accuracy, clarity, and consistency. Manage documentation version control and maintain a centralized repository for all technical documents. Participate in data center projects to document new installations, upgrades, and process improvements. Aid in creating training materials for data center staff and end-users. Stay current with industry trends and emerging technologies in data center operations. Qualifications
Bachelor's degree in Technical Writing, English, Information Technology, or a related field. 3-5 years of experience in technical writing, preferably in IT or data center environments. Strong understanding of data center operations, infrastructure, and technologies. Excellent writing, editing, and proofreading skills with a keen eye for detail. Proficiency in technical writing tools and software. Ability to understand and communicate complex technical concepts to various audiences. Strong interpersonal and communication skills for effective collaboration with technical teams. Familiarity with industry standards and best practices (e.g., ITIL, ISO 27001, DCIM). Seniority level
